In 2016-2018, an estimated 19% of U.S. children and 15% of California children ages 0-17 had special health care needs (meaning they had or were at increased risk for a chronic physical, developmental, behavioral, or emotional condition and required health and related services of a type or amount beyond that required by children generally). Definition of Children with Special Health Care Needs: Children with special health care needs are those who have or are at increased risk for a chronic physical, developmental, behavioral, or emotional condition and who also require health and related services of a type or amount beyond that required by children generally (AAP, Pediatrics 102:1, July 1998). Children with special needs means children with developmental disabilities, mental retardation, emotional disturbance, sensory or motor impairment, or significant chronic illness who require special health surveillance or specialized programs, interventions, technologies, or facilities. In general, educational provision for children with special needs is made: In special schools; In special classes attached to ordinary schools; In integrated settings in mainstream classes.
